Output 74003bb0ba818636dac3f62c18bf04c3004120fd8ba9c292740cdf0dd58c758e:0

value
26993340
script pubkey
OP_0 OP_PUSHBYTES_20 7138ea267235c75833e3573081a536d6baba5cca
address
ltc1qwyuw5fnjxhr4svlr2ucgrffk66at5hx20f9mh3
transaction
74003bb0ba818636dac3f62c18bf04c3004120fd8ba9c292740cdf0dd58c758e
spent
true